Ingredients
Scale
- 1 pound ground beef
- 1/4 cup breadcrumbs
- 1 egg
- 1 tablespoon Worcestershire sauce
- 1 teaspoon garlic powder
- Salt and pepper to taste
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- 1 cup beef broth
- 1/2 cup sour cream
- 2 tablespoons fresh dill, chopped
- 1 teaspoon Dijon mustard
Instructions
- Mix together the ground beef, breadcrumbs, egg, Worcestershire sauce, garlic powder, salt, and pepper until well combined. Shape into patties.
- Heat olive oil in a skillet over medium heat and cook the patties until browned on both sides and cooked through, about 4-5 minutes per side. Remove the patties and set aside.
- Add beef broth to the same skillet and bring to a simmer. Stir in sour cream, dill, and Dijon mustard until smooth.
- Return the hamburger steaks to the skillet and spoon the sauce over them. Simmer for an additional 2-3 minutes to heat through.
- Serve warm with your choice of sides.
Notes
For a stronger flavor, let the patties marinate in the refrigerator for 30 minutes before cooking. If you prefer a thicker sauce, add cornstarch mixed with water to the broth while simmering. Customize by using ground turkey or chicken and adding sautéed onions or mushrooms.
